Output 74ded62210c1bfcbe5e919e1e992d406ebadd4e22e9becc80ee49e3ccb68c668:1

value
1005632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ab5538ca1c0163482bdcc2ab975febb48e930a7 OP_EQUAL
address
3ELSPnx2hJzwCXM2XywHfDfZkDXh88aQTu
transaction
74ded62210c1bfcbe5e919e1e992d406ebadd4e22e9becc80ee49e3ccb68c668
spent
true